Letter to the editor,

Thank you for highlighting the Taylor Oral History collection at the William Breman Jewish Heritage Museum.

As more people learn about history from the internet, it becomes more important to make documents, primary sources, and oral recollections available to others. Part of learning about who we are is learning about our history.

The Jewish Genealogical Society of Georgia, with support from The Breman Museum, has indexed all of the interviews in the Tayor Oral History collection. This index is available in the USA Database on JewishGen.org at: www.jewishgen.org/databases/USA

In addition, The Breman Museum’s Holocaust interviews are also included in the JewishGen.org Holocaust Database at: www.jewishgen.org/databases/Holocaust
Anyone researching their family during the Holocaust should check this database as it includes a variety of other sources including paper records and the Shoah Foundation interviews.

Peggy Mosinger Freedman, Jewish Genealogical Society of Georgia
